排序
告別繁瑣的字符串處理:使用 voku/portable-ascii 提升效率
最近在開發(fā)一個在線問卷系統(tǒng)時,遇到了一個令人頭疼的問題:用戶提交的答案中包含各種各樣的字符,包括中文、日文、特殊符號等等。這些非ascii字符導(dǎo)致我的php代碼在處理字符串時效率極低,甚至...
如何下載安裝yii2.0框架
在安裝yii2.0框架之前,得先在windows系統(tǒng)上安裝好php web環(huán)境,這是php開發(fā)的前提。在windows上安裝php web環(huán)境可以選擇一些集成環(huán)境,一鍵安裝很方便,例如phpstudy。 確認(rèn)是否安裝了composer...
win環(huán)境下如何安裝yii框架?
第一種:歸檔文件形式安裝(適合于沒有安裝composer的機(jī)器) 進(jìn)入下載頁https://www.yiiframework.com/download,選擇下載第一個 下載完成之后是一個壓縮包,解壓文件夾,放到指定的項(xiàng)目目錄文...
TP6 Think-Swoole RPC服務(wù)的服務(wù)監(jiān)控與報警機(jī)制
TP6 Think-Swoole RPC服務(wù)的服務(wù)監(jiān)控與報警機(jī)制 在開發(fā)過程中,我們經(jīng)常會使用到RPC(Remote Procedure Call,遠(yuǎn)程過程調(diào)用)服務(wù)來實(shí)現(xiàn)不同服務(wù)之間的通信。而在TP6框架中,我們可以利用Think-...
如何在處理大型遺留代碼時高效使用PHP_CodeSniffer?sirbrillig/phpcs-changed庫助你優(yōu)化代碼審查!
可以通過以下地址學(xué)習(xí) Composer:學(xué)習(xí)地址 在處理大型遺留項(xiàng)目時,如何高效地使用 php_codesniffer(phpcs)進(jìn)行代碼審查是一個常見的問題。特別是當(dāng)你需要在已有大量 phpcs 錯誤的文件中添加新...
如何解決PHP中的并行處理問題?使用amphp/parallel-functions可以!
可以通過以下地址學(xué)習(xí)Composer:學(xué)習(xí)地址 在開發(fā)高性能的php應(yīng)用時,如何高效處理并行任務(wù)是一個常見且棘手的問題。我最近在開發(fā)一個需要同時處理多個http請求的項(xiàng)目中,遇到了性能瓶頸。嘗試了...
分享laravel超好用程序提示工具Laravel IDE Helper
laravel教程:laravel 超好用程序提示工具 Laravel IDE Helper安裝 安裝 larave-ide-helper# 如果只想在開發(fā)環(huán)境 安裝請加上 --dev composer require barryvdh/laravel-ide-helper安裝 doctrine...
使用Docker快捷安裝Symfony
使用Docker快捷安裝Symfony 簡介:Symfony是一個流行的PHP Web應(yīng)用框架,它提供了許多功能和工具,幫助開發(fā)者快速構(gòu)建高質(zhì)量的Web應(yīng)用。為了方便地安裝和運(yùn)行Symfony,我們可以使用Docker來創(chuàng)建...
告別混亂財務(wù)數(shù)據(jù):使用 Abivia/Ledger 打造清晰財務(wù)系統(tǒng)
我們的項(xiàng)目涉及到多個國家的業(yè)務(wù),需要處理不同幣種的財務(wù)數(shù)據(jù),同時還需要追蹤每筆交易的完整歷史,以便進(jìn)行審計(jì)。最初,我們使用簡單的數(shù)據(jù)庫表來存儲財務(wù)數(shù)據(jù),但隨著數(shù)據(jù)量的增加,管理變得...
簡化 Elasticsearch 查詢:plexcellmedia/elasticsearch 庫的實(shí)際應(yīng)用
在處理一個大型的電商平臺項(xiàng)目時,我需要實(shí)現(xiàn)一個高效的搜索引擎來處理數(shù)百萬條商品數(shù)據(jù)。elasticsearch 是一個很好的選擇,但其查詢語法復(fù)雜,常常讓我感到困惑和無從下手。嘗試了多種方法后,...